What Florida Law Says About Dog Bites

Florida has strict liability laws when it comes to dog bites. This means a dog owner can be held legally responsible for injuries caused by their dog, even if the dog has never shown aggression before.

Key elements of Florida’s dog bite law include:

  • Owners are liable if the victim was in a public place or lawfully on private property.
  • Negligence doesn’t have to be proven for liability.
  • Comparative fault can reduce compensation if the victim was partially responsible (e.g., provoking the dog).

First Things First: Ensure Safety and Report the Accident

Even if a Fort Pierce fender bender seems minor, it’s important to prioritize safety. Move vehicles out of the roadway if possible to prevent further accidents. Check for injuries and call 911 if anyone needs medical attention. In Florida, you are required to report an accident to law enforcement if there are injuries or if property damage exceeds $500.

Having a police report on file is crucial. It serves as an official record of what happened and can be instrumental if you decide to pursue a personal injury claim. Even a low-speed impact can cause whiplash or soft tissue injuries that aren’t immediately apparent.

Step 1: Know the Value of Your Vehicle

The first step discussed in the video is understanding the true value of your vehicle. After a collision, the insurance company will determine what they believe your car was worth before the accident. However, their assessment doesn’t always reflect your vehicle’s real market value.

Your Lake Worth car accident lawyer at Adolphe Law Group will explain that insurance companies often use third-party databases or automated valuation tools to calculate a settlement. These systems may overlook key factors such as custom upgrades, excellent maintenance, or exceptionally low mileage—all of which can increase your car’s value.

To counter this, it’s important to research comparable vehicles in your area. Check listings on reputable car sale platforms to see what cars of the same make, model, and condition are selling for locally. Keep detailed records of maintenance, receipts for upgrades, and any evidence that demonstrates your car’s worth.

Step 2: Ask the Insurance Adjuster for a Comparison Report

The second tip from Adolphe Law Group’s “Property Damage after a Car Accident” video is to request a comparison report directly from your insurance adjuster. This report should list the vehicles the insurer used to determine your car’s value.

Far too often, these comparison vehicles are not truly comparable—they may be older, higher in mileage, or located in a completely different region where market prices are lower. When you ask to see the comparison report, you can identify inconsistencies or unfair valuations.

1. Statute of Limitations in Florida

The first critical point is Florida’s statute of limitations. In most personal injury cases, you generally have two years from the date of the incident to file a lawsuit. Waiting too long can result in losing your legal right to pursue compensation. 2. Speaking to or Giving a Recorded Statement to the Insurance Adjuster

This second mistake is arguably one of the most damaging. Insurance adjusters are trained to gather statements that appear harmless but can be used strategically against you later.

A recorded statement, even if voluntary, can be edited and used to challenge your memory or suggest inconsistencies in your account. Unfortunately, such statements are often admissible in court, and every word you say can be twisted to favor the insurer.

1. Florida Is a No-Fault State

Florida follows a no-fault car insurance system. This means that after most car accidents, you first turn to your own insurance policy for compensation—regardless of who caused the crash.

The key here is PIP insurance, short for Personal Injury Protection. Florida law requires all drivers to carry a minimum of $10,000 in PIP coverage. This coverage pays for medical expenses and lost wages after an accident, but it doesn’t cover everything.

2. No-Fault Doesn’t Mean the At-Fault Party Escapes Responsibility

While Florida’s no-fault rules require you to use PIP first, the at-fault party can still be held responsible in certain situations. If your injuries are permanent, result in significant and permanent loss of bodily function, cause significant scarring or disfigurement, or result in death, you can pursue a claim directly against the negligent party.

3. The Statute of Limitations Is Two Years in Florida

Time is critical in personal injury cases. In Florida, you have two years from the date of the accident (or the date of death in wrongful death cases) to file a lawsuit.

6. Florida Is a Modified Comparative Negligence State

Florida follows a modified comparative negligence rule. This means you can still recover damages if you were partially at fault for the accident—as long as you are less than 50% at fault.

However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. For example, if you are awarded $100,000 but are found to be 20% at fault, you will receive $80,000.

8. You Can Sue for Punitive Damages

Punitive damages are awarded not to compensate you, but to punish the defendant for especially reckless or intentional misconduct.

Examples include drunk driving accidents, fraudulent conduct, or intentional harm. Florida law caps punitive damages at three times the amount of compensatory damages or $500,000, whichever is greater—though exceptions exist in certain cases.
